Solution for (2x+24)(2x+16)=660 equation:


Simplifying
(2x + 24)(2x + 16) = 660

Reorder the terms:
(24 + 2x)(2x + 16) = 660

Reorder the terms:
(24 + 2x)(16 + 2x) = 660

Multiply (24 + 2x) * (16 + 2x)
(24(16 + 2x) + 2x * (16 + 2x)) = 660
((16 * 24 + 2x * 24) + 2x * (16 + 2x)) = 660
((384 + 48x) + 2x * (16 + 2x)) = 660
(384 + 48x + (16 * 2x + 2x * 2x)) = 660
(384 + 48x + (32x + 4x2)) = 660

Combine like terms: 48x + 32x = 80x
(384 + 80x + 4x2) = 660

Solving
384 + 80x + 4x2 = 660

Solving for variable 'x'.

Reorder the terms:
384 + -660 + 80x + 4x2 = 660 + -660

Combine like terms: 384 + -660 = -276
-276 + 80x + 4x2 = 660 + -660

Combine like terms: 660 + -660 = 0
-276 + 80x + 4x2 = 0

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'4'.
4(-69 + 20x + x2) = 0

Factor a trinomial.
4((-23 + -1x)(3 + -1x)) = 0

Ignore the factor 4.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-23 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-23 + -1x = 0 Solving -23 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'23' to each side of the equation. -23 + 23 + -1x = 0 + 23 Combine like terms: -23 + 23 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+ 23 -1x = 0 + 23 Combine like terms: 0 + 23 = 23 -1x = 23 Divide each side by '-1'. x = -23 Simplifying x = -23

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(3 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 3 + -1x = 0 Solving 3 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-3' to each side of the equation. 3 + -3 + -1x =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-3 -1x =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3 -1x = -3 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 3 Simplifying x = 3

Solution

x = {-23, 3}
